All rights reserved. http://www.usgwarchives.net/copyright.htm http://www.usgwarchives.net/va/vafiles.htm ************************************************ HENRY LUTHER HUNNINGS Henry Luther Hunnings, 80, a retired Union Bag-Camp Paper Corp. carpenter, died Friday afternoon in the home of his son, Luther Hunnings, after a short illness. He was the husband of Mrs. Ada Hunnings of Franklin and a son of Henry and Mrs. Elizabeth Bennett Hunnings of Beaufort County, N.C. He was a member of Hunterdale Christian Church. Surviving are another son, Walter W. Hunnings, of Alexandria; two daughters, Mrs. Jesse H. Scott and Mrs. Kirby Ham of Franklin; one brother, Walter Hunnings of Norfolk; two sisters, Mrs. W.R. Keech of Norfolk and Mrs. Mittie Jones of Royal, N.C.; 16 grandchildren and six great-grandchildren. The body was taken to W.J.M. Holland & Sons Funeral Home. The family was in the home of Mrs. Jesse H. Scott in Hunterdale.
